_______________________________________

LoQOII

Officially Announced - Sometime in 2011
Officially Released - Friday, February 7, 2014

Production time - Approximately 3 years
This game was made without funding and I worked full time on it since I at the time was unemployed and had nothing else to do with my life. ;P 

LoQO:O Episode I

Officially Announced - Tuesday, February 11, 2014
Officially Released - Sunday, August 30, 2015

Production Time - 1 year, 6 months
This part was made with Offbeatr crowdfunding and I worked full time as I considered it my job, the end product had nearly the same amount of locations as LoQOII, less story but more CG scenes.

LoQO:O Episode II

Officially Announced - Tuesday, September 15, 2015
Officially Released - Saturday, April 8, 2017

Production Time - 1 year, 7 months
This part was made with Patreon funding and I worked full time as I considered it my job, the end product about equal in size with LoQOII but with more locations and far more CG scenes.

Either way, development is coming along nicely without any hiccups!
Latest additions to be featured is the Encyclopedia being corrected to include all the new titles and updating locations/monsters progression, but I've also been adding the first Ultra and seven more Legendary Monsters (which brings the total up to 20 for episode 2).
For those who remember what an "Ultra" is from LoQOII, it's essentially an even tougher Legendary Monster but also more unique and tied to a cutscene or side-story, rather than just being a fight.

I also think the final beta before the public release will be hitting next week, so we're almost there!
